I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E MIDDLE DISTRICT OF PENNSYLVANIA SUSAN M. KEGERISE, Plaintiff v. SUSQUEHANNA TOWNSHIP SCHOOL DISTRICT, et al., Defendants : : : : : : : : No. 1:14-cv-0747 (Judge Kane) ORDER AND NOW, on this 21st day of June 2018, upon consideration of Defendants’ second motion for summary judgment (Doc. No. 152), IT IS ORDERED THAT: 1. Defendants’ motion (Doc. No. 152), is GRANTED as to Counts II, III, and VIII of Plaintiff’s third amended complaint (Doc. No. 39), and the Clerk is directed to enter judgment in favor of Defendants and against Plaintiff upon the conclusion of the above-captioned action; 2. Defendants’ motion (Doc. No. 152), is DENIED as to Counts IV, VII, IX, X, and XII of the third amended complaint (Doc. No. 39); 3. Plaintiff is permitted to file a motion for leave to file an amended complaint pursuant to Federal Rule of Civil Procedure 15(a) within fourteen (14) days of the date of this Order, and in accordance with the Memorandum entered concurrently with this Order; and 4. A status conference is scheduled in the above-captioned action for Friday, August 17, 2018 at 11:30 a.m. The Court prefers to conduct this conference by telephone. Plaintiff’s counsel shall initiate the call. The telephone number of the Court is 717221-3990. s/ Yvette Kane Yvette Kane, District Judge United States District Court Middle District of Pennsylvania
